A diver went 25.65 feet below the surface of the ocean, and then 16.5 feet further down, he rose 12.45 feet.

I guess you want to find where the diver ended up.

Taking distance below the surface to be negative we have:-

-25.65 - 16.5 + 12.65

= -42.15 + 12.45

= -29.7 feet

That is 29.7 feet below the surface.
